## Local Setup

Marrowkit plugins now build under the Hermix hermetic toolchain. Delete any `.marrow-cache` directories first; stale artifacts break sandbox hashing. Run `hermix fetch` to pin dependencies, then `hermix build //plugins/...` — no system compilers are consulted. Plugin authors targeting the old Gradle path must migrate before the Q3 cutoff; shims were removed. Verification queries run against the local registry mirror, so the build needs the connection string below.

database URL for baguf-kajop: redis://fraox_svc:Yw@db-077d.orvexgrid.local:5432/aldmir

# Pilot: Merrowmart Rollout (Managers Only)

Status: live in 12 stores across the Delving region. Merrowmart's ops team handles shelf integration; our Fieldhawk units report uptime above target. Two hardware swaps so far, both resolved within a day. Weekly syncs run Tuesdays, led by Priya on our side. Expansion to 40 stores hinges on the December review. Incoming director should read the pilot charter before the next sync. The commercial terms under discussion are captured in the note below.

internal memo for yahag-hahig: Belwynix Group plans to lower the Silir list price by 62 percent in May.

Subject: Fernledger report builder — sorting stability fix shipped

Hello plugin authors,

We've released a correction to the Fernledger report builder's sort pipeline. Previously, rows with equal sort keys could reorder between renders, which broke plugins relying on stable positions. Sorting is now guaranteed stable across pagination and re-renders. Please re-run your integration suites and report regressions through the usual channel. The build token for this release follows.

build token for kagaf-hahof: htk14_9d3d4d26d7d8de

**Mgmt Meeting Minutes — Retiring the Brightline Range**

Quick recap for sales leads at Fenholt Supplies: we agreed to retire the Brightline fixture range by year-end. Remaining stock moves to clearance pricing next month, and accounts on standing orders get migrated to the Lumetta range. Trade-in incentives were approved in principle. The confidential note on next steps sits just below.

board note of bajof-bajeg: The pricing group signed off on a budget of $13.4 million for Project Sildor. The renewal with Lamixek Holdings closes at $48.9 million a year, 49 percent above the last contract.